Brain dump:
- removed a bunch of system gids from NIS, as they were clashing
and contained no actual users. pre-change version is in
/var/yp/src/group.presystemripout. I don't *think* this should
break anything, but if it does, just put the offending ones back.
- dispense is happy again. Took some hacking to get it to work
properly, but it'll get a rewrite these holidays. I promise :)
- door should open too. hasn't been tested though.
- IMAP server is now dovecot. It's more secure, faster, and doesn't
let people crawl all over mooneye's filesystem
- firewalls on all the reinstalled machines are in
/etc/init.d/ucc-fw . They're pretty tight, so if something
network related isn't working, it's most probably this.
They are activated from /etc/rcS.d/S41ucc-fw, and also when
bringing up the world-accessible aliases (ssh, telnet,
flame-tunnel), to make sure the NAT stuff works.
